Today there is jumps racing at Uttoxeter while on the flat there are cards at Ascot, Thirsk, York, Chepstow and Sandown. In Ireland, They race over both codes with the jumps at Kilbeggan and on the flat at Cork.

Yesterday we had one runner at Sandown, Ocean Heights ran in the 4:20pm and ran well to finish third, it was a fairly competitive race even with such a small field but he kept on well running all the way to the line.   

Today we head to Uttoxeter with three runners. Bashful Boy runs in the 3:20pm Handicap Hurdle over 2miles 4f with Jack Tudor riding. He ran well on his last start and it was an improvement on from his previous runs so hopefully, he can continue to improve again.

Back In The Bay runs in the 4:30pm Mares’ Bumper over 2miles with Jack Tudor in the saddle. She ran well on stable debut finishing 4th and she ran on well to the line just getting caught for a couple of places, so I’m sure there will be plenty of improvement from that run and she is a likeable mare.

Our last runner of the day is Chemical Warfare who runs in the 5:35pm Handicap Chase over 3miles 2f, again with Jack Tudor in the saddle. He showed a tough performance last time out to get his head in front with his return back to fences. This is step up in distance today, but he is capable of improving more I think. 

We also heard the sad news of one of jump racing’s most iconic equine superstars, Istabraq who sadly passed away at the age of 32. He was an incredible horse and his CV certainly showed that. He was retired to JP McManus’ home in Ireland and extremely well looked after at his fantastic facility and only two months ago, celebrated his birthday and was pictured at the centre of a large gathering and it was said that he received many birthday cards!
